Sembcorp Green Infra Ltd (SGIL), one of India’s top 10 renewable independent power producers, has filed a draft red herring prospectus for an initial public offering to raise up to ₹3,750 crore entirely through a fresh issue of equity shares, with no offer-for-sale component. The proceeds will be used solely to repay borrowings at the company and subsidiary level.

The Singapore-backed company, promoted by Sembcorp Utilities Pte. Ltd. and Sembcorp Industries Ltd., operates a total portfolio of approximately 7.64GW/GWh, comprising 3.60GW of operational capacity and roughly 4.04GW/GWh under construction. Its operational base includes 2.09GW of wind, 1.42GW of solar, and 88.40MW of hybrid capacity spread across 105 projects in 13 States and Union Territories.

A significant portion of its under-construction pipeline — 3.58GW, consists of what the company calls complex projects: hybrid, storage-linked, round-the-clock and firm and dispatchable renewable energy configurations. SGIL also has 1,433MWh of battery energy storage capacity under construction. The company reported a 77.32 per cent bid success ratio for complex projects between FY24 and FY26.

Financially, SGIL reported revenue from operations of ₹2,652 crore in FY26, up from ₹2,249 crore in FY24, with EBITDA margins holding above 74 per cent across all three years. Profit after tax stood at ₹371 crore in FY26. The company carries a net debt-to-equity ratio of 1.52x and holds an AA+ (Stable) rating from CRISIL, ICRA, and India Ratings.

The IPO comes as India’s power sector braces for a large investment cycle, with CRISIL Intelligence projecting ₹37–42 trillion in power-sector spending between FY2027 and FY2031, driven by a target to cross 340GW of peak demand by FY31.
